Purchasing Estimator Summary : Responsible for managing all activities involved with creating and maintaining material take-offs.

  • Minimum high school diploma or equivalent required - Minimum 2 years experience in purchasing and estimating required - Ability to read and understand residential blue prints.
  • Efficient with Microsoft Excel, Microsoft Word, JD Edwards, and other software systems. - Knowledge of all construction practices nation-wide.
  • Ability to perform several tasks efficiently under tight deadlines. - Detail oriented, energetic, and hard-working personality.
  • Valid Driver's License with good driving record - Valid Auto Insurance Coverage Contacts : Daily interaction with various division personnel, outside agencies, business partners, and consultants.

Physical Requirements : This is primarily a sedentary office position which requires the ability to occasionally bend, stoop, reach, lift, move, and carry office supplies weighing twenty-five (25) pounds or less.

Finger dexterity is required to operate computer keyboard, calculator, and telephone equipment. Ability to operate a motor vehicle.

  • Estimate materials for new plans. - Create and maintain accurate material take-offs. - Monitor material usage in the field for overages / shortages to update / correct material take-offs.
  • Record and analyze take-off data through Microsoft Excel. - Assist Division team with plan value engineering. - Maintain Division's insurance compliance.
  • Update / Correct purchase order issues. - Complete required forms by the Regional Operations Center (ROC). - Maintain vendor files and contracts.
  • Prepare bid requests for new / existing plans. - Assist in evaluating new bid proposals.
